Cortical activities during visually-guided saccades -- an fMRI-MEG integration study --
Keita Shirasawa, Jiuk Jung, Takenori Oida, Tetsuo Kobayashi (Kyoto Univ.) NC2008-49
Abstract (in Japanese) (See Japanese page) 
(in English) In this study, brain activities during subjects performing visually-guided saccade tasks were measured and analyzed by the combination of fMRI and MEG. An apparent motion stimulus was used during a control experiment. Event-related neuromagnetic fields were obtained by a 306-channel MEG system, whereas fMRI data were acquired by a 1.5T MR system. Eight healthy with normal and corrected -to-normal visual acuity participated in the experiments. To determine the latency of saccade in each subject, EOGs were measured simultaneously. Although there were individual differences, the integrative fMRI-MEG technique successfully detected dynamic neural activities in multiple visual areas, such as V1/V2, MT+/V5, intraparietal sulcus and frontal eye field. The results demonstrate that the MT+/V5 activates before starting visually-guided saccade.
